Seven of Cups & Three of Pentacles
Combined Meaning
When the Seven of Cups and Three of Pentacles appear together, they illustrate a powerful dynamic between the realm of dreams and the reality of collaboration. This tarot pairing encourages not only envisioning possibilities but actively working with others to bring those visions to life.
Together, these cards invite you to balance imagination with practical action. The Seven of Cups inspires exploration of your options and creative potential, while the Three of Pentacles grounds this energy into teamwork and craftsmanship. This pairing suggests that success comes when dreams are shared, skills combined, and ideas constructed through collaboration. Beware of getting lost in fantasy alone; instead, use partnerships as a foundation to manifest your aspirations realistically and effectively. This combination is ideal for projects requiring brainstorming and cooperative execution, highlighting how ideas become tangible through collective effort.

Advice from the Cards
General Advice
Focus on clarifying your goals amidst many options and seek partnerships where skills complement your vision. Avoid daydreaming without action; instead, channel your creativity into collaborative projects that build real results.
Love Advice
In relationships, this combination advises you to dream openly about possibilities but also to work together with your partner to create a strong, supportive foundation. Shared goals and honest communication will turn ideals into lasting bonds.
Career Advice
Professionally, this pairing encourages you to brainstorm broadly and then engage with colleagues or mentors to develop your ideas. Successful projects require both creative vision and cooperative effort — harness both for career advancement.
Health Advice
For health, visualize positive outcomes and explore different wellness options, but seek guidance and support from practitioners or peers to implement effective and sustainable habits.
